## Releases

Version 2.4.1 of Pixelhoard fixes the memory leak in the thumbnail cache: evicted entries now release their native buffers immediately instead of waiting for finalization. Plugin authors relying on the old cache hooks should migrate to `onEvict`. All release artifacts are signed; verify downloads with the key below.

release key, fajef-kajeg: bky19_LdLu6Ne6FLi8he2c24d

Handover note — GridPull export memory

Welcome aboard. GridPull's spreadsheet export buffers whole sheets in memory, which is why big tenant exports spike the heap. Mira added streaming for CSV last quarter; XLSX is still buffered, capped by a row limit. If you tune anything, change one knob at a time and watch the heap graphs. Current production settings for the export worker are as follows.

deployment values, fafog-fawip:
[jorox]
team = fendor
access_code = ac_bb00ea
host = jorox.qorveltech.internal
port = 9200
owner = istdor.aldeth
peer = julvan.orvexlabs.internal

**Vendor note: Inkmill markdown pipeline**

Rendering for Parchway docs is outsourced to Inkmill under an annual contract, renewing each March. They handle sanitization and PDF export; we own the upload queue. SLA: 4-hour response on rendering failures. Escalate only after two failed retries. Their support desk is reachable at the address below.

billing contact of hahaf-baguf = zorael.tammir.jorius@sivrelhq.internal